RCV004766668 | SCV005381648 | pathogenic | Neuronal ceroid lipofuscinosis | 2024-08-01 | criteria provided, single submitter | clinical testing | Variant summary: CTSF c.593_594delAT (p.Tyr198X) results in a premature termination codon, predicted to cause a truncation of the encoded protein or absence of the protein due to nonsense mediated decay, which are commonly known mechanisms for disease. The variant was absent in 251482 control chromosomes. To our knowledge, no occurrence of c.593_594delAT in individuals affected with Neuronal Ceroid-Lipofuscinosis (Batten Disease) has been reported. No submitters have cited clinical-significance assessments for this variant to ClinVar. Based on the evidence outlined above, the variant was classified as pathogenic. |
